Adult CPR: deepness, rhythm, and scene management
Most neighborhood heart attacks include adults, and the grown-up method establishes the standard. The criterion is 30 compressions to 2 breaths, compressing a 3rd of the breast depth, roughly 5 to 6 centimeters. That deepness is non-negotiable if you intend to relocate blood. The rhythm kicks back 100 to 120 compressions per min. Think about the pace of a quick marching beat. Too slow, and perfusion decreases. As well fast, and compressions end up being too shallow.
In courses throughout emergency treatment training in Oxley, the first obstacle is getting individuals to commit to correct depth. It really feels counterintuitive, especially when the chest crackles, but inadequate deepness is a common reason for poor outcomes. Fitness instructors will coach you with hand placement on the lower half of the sternum and the significance of full upper body recoil in between compressions. Recoil is what refills the heart for the next push.
Breaths issue, though not as long as compressions when you get on your own. If you are educated and equipped with a face guard, aim for two gentle breaths that lift the chest without requiring air into the belly. If you are inexperienced or uneasy with rescue breaths, hands-only CPR at the proper price and depth serves until aid gets here. Every Oxley emergency treatment course emphasizes calling three-way no early, putting your phone on speaker, and adhering to dispatcher instructions while you work.
Automated outside defibrillators prevail in Oxley community hubs, gyms, and retail centers. The tools are uncomplicated, however unfamiliarity still causes hesitation. In mouth-to-mouth resuscitation programs Oxley facilitators run, you will exercise opening up the AED, connecting pads to a bare breast, standing clear for evaluation, and providing a shock if recommended. The gadget speak to you, and you follow it. The method is lessening disturbance to compressions while the AED prepares. Excellent groups exercise that handoff.
Child mouth-to-mouth resuscitation: strong method with a lighter touch
Children are not little grownups. Their bones and body organs sit in various proportions, and their upper bodies call for less force. For a kid, aim for one third of chest deepness, typically about 5 centimeters, still at 100 to 120 compressions per minute. Make use of one or two hands relying on the size of the youngster and your very own strength. Overzealous compressions run the risk of injury, but shy compressions fall short to flow blood. Training bridges that space with mannequins sized for key college bodies and instant feedback on depth.
The reasons for cardiac arrest vary too. In children, breathing problems lead more often to arrest than in adults. That moves the weight slightly towards effective air flow. Emergency treatment and mouth-to-mouth resuscitation courses Oxley teachers run will show air passage placing with a neutral head tilt, proper mask seal for breaths, and the signals that your breaths are too strong. If the upper body does not increase on the first attempt, rearrange before the 2nd. If there is no rise on the 2nd breath, action right back to compressions.
Parents and carers often inquire about fear of causing injury. In a true arrest, risk skews toward passivity. Bruises and even rib fractures are acceptable compromises when the option is irreparable brain injury. Experienced trainers deal with those fears freely, sharing instances where timely CPR returned a youngster to institution within weeks.

Infant mouth-to-mouth resuscitation: precision, gentle air, and choking risks
Infants demand a lot more precise strategy. The breast is smaller sized and extra compliant, and the air passage is quickly bewildered by too much air. For a baby under one year, compress to one third of chest deepness, regarding 4 centimeters. Use two fingers for an only rescuer or the two-thumb surrounding technique if 2 rescuers are present. Keep the price at 100 to 120 per min. Rescue breaths are little puffs, simply sufficient to see chest rise.
Many arrests in this age group comply with breathing issues or choking. Oxley emergency treatment programs consist of repeated drills on baby choking, because once you've practiced 5 back slaps and 5 upper body drives on an infant manikin, your hands will recognize what to do with an actual infant. The angle, support of the head and neck, and the pressure of each slap have to be right. Instructors will walk you through usual pitfalls, like slapping too softly via worry or as well hard without appropriate support.

Practical differences that matter in the genuine world
It is something to memorize grown-up, child, and infant formulas. It is an additional to adapt them in the middle of actual restrictions. Below are situations that come up over and over in Oxley emergency treatment training:
- A fell down adult in a limited area. You may need to drag the individual to a company, open surface area prior to compressions. Trainers will reveal risk-free strategies making use of a shirt collar or underarm drag to prevent back injuries. An infant choking in a stroller. The very first step is lifting the infant out to a safe position along your lower arm, with the head lower than the chest. Deliver controlled back slaps while preserving a safe grip. A child on a trampoline with a believed neck injury. In many arrests, compressions take priority over back precautions. If the youngster is unresponsive and not breathing typically, begin compressions on the trampoline only if it is firm enough to enable reliable depth, or relocate the youngster onto a company surface area with careful support. A damp or perspiring chest at a swimming pool or gym. Dry the chest quickly where pads will certainly go. Water can trigger pads to slip or arc. Some AED sets include a tiny towel or gauze for this reason. A bearded chest. If hair stops great pad contact, make use of the razor from the AED package to clear the pad area rapidly. One pad can serve as a wax strip if a razor is missing, after that replace it with a fresh pad.
Those tiny, practiced steps shield compression top quality and pad adhesion, which straight affect outcomes.
The function of oxygen and respiratory tract, without overcomplicating it
Debates over oxygenation versus blood circulation can perplex new trainees. In neighborhood setups without innovative devices, the concern stays compressions with minimal disturbance. Respiratory tract monitoring need to be easy and efficient. Head tilt and chin lift, a good mask seal, and small, sluggish breaths that lift the chest. In infants, be gentler still, maintaining the head neutral to stay clear of air passage kinks.

Agonal breathing shakes off several onlookers. It appears like occasional gasps and can be noisy. It is not regular breathing. If the person is less competent and gasping, treat it as heart attack and start mouth-to-mouth resuscitation. Training courses in Oxley reinforce this with video clip and audio instances, because when you have listened to agonal respirations, you will certainly not mistake them again.
AEDs around Oxley: where they are and how to think about them
Public-access AEDs are expanding in number across Oxley's buying areas, sporting activities clubs, and neighborhood halls. Not every location will have one within a min's reach, but you need to create a routine of noticing AED signs where you spend time. When an arrest occurs, the very best department of labor is basic: a single person begins compressions, another calls three-way no and fetches the AED. If you are alone, telephone call initially on audio speaker, start compressions, and leave just if the AED is within an extremely brief distance.
AEDs examine the heart rhythm and advise whether a shock is needed. You can not harm someone by using the pads and adhering to motivates. If the rhythm is not shockable, the device will say proceed CPR. If a shock is advised, ensure no person is touching the client, supply the shock, and return to compressions quickly. Common concerns from Oxley participants, answered briefly
- Will I get in lawful problem for trying mouth-to-mouth resuscitation? Good-faith aid is secured by regulation. In training, you will find out authorization and duty of treatment basics, together with exactly how to document what you did. What if I damage a rib? It takes place. Appropriate hand placement and technique minimize risk, however in an arrest, blood circulation takes precedence. How long should I continue mouth-to-mouth resuscitation? Up until the individual shows indications of life, an AED advises or else, or paramedics take control of. Tiredness sets in earlier than the majority of expect, so swap compressors every 2 minutes if aid is available. Can I use an AED on a kid or infant? Yes, with pediatric pads if readily available. If not, make use of grown-up pads and change positioning to prevent overlap, such as one on the breast and one on the back. Is mouth-to-mouth required? If trained and equipped, provide rescue breaths. If not, hands-only mouth-to-mouth resuscitation serves. Compressions are the priority.
